Output 2581e2926f960a08425f3d8de0870b85b505828bebd35a74b0195e1e48d1d889:2

value
1079581
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ec23331cc006d86d2bc1ea046739e58c584a3014 OP_EQUALVERIFY OP_CHECKSIG
address
1NXadzFT9eprfuY8f81WkyjaePBshkcnaa
transaction
2581e2926f960a08425f3d8de0870b85b505828bebd35a74b0195e1e48d1d889
spent
true